The bus back to Bangkok was uneventful. Lindsey's scorched skin made it less than pleasant (for both of us), but we rolled into BKK on time and headed for our hotel. We had been staying in the same place off and on for a couple of months now and it was starting to feel like home, at least more like home than anywhere else we'd stayed for the last 8 months.
That concluded our traveling for a while. Amy left early the next day and we began our efforts to find a place to live in Bangkok. We both quickly found jobs, and after a few more days at the hotel, we sub-let a room in a condo on Sukhumvit 20 for a month. While we were there, we found our own place near Lindsey's office.
